Overview

GBix is an alternative investment platform that opens access to previously exclusive assets—like real estate, art, wine, and crypto—to a broader class of retail investors. GBix is a product of Gold Bullion International (GBI) and created by the team behind Hard Assets Alliance (HAA), GBix aimed to become the “Robinhood of alternative assets,” offering both high-net-worth and everyday investors a trusted, modern platform.

Goji Labs led the user research, UX strategy, and design system development for this greenfield product—positioning it for market entry, regulatory approval, and scale.

The Challenge

Bridging the gap between two very different investor profiles:

  1. Conservative Wealth Holders (from HAA) — skeptical of crypto and newer assets, but willing to convert if trust and ease were established.
  2. Younger, Risk-Tolerant Users — familiar with platforms like Robinhood but needing guidance through complex investment types.

We needed to build a single platform that simplified sophisticated investments while maintaining the credibility and trustworthiness expected by high-cap investors.

Our Approach

We translated complex financial products into a flexible, user-friendly experience:

  1. User Interviews + Market Research: Mapped investor psychology across two distinct user types
  2. Information Architecture + Logic Mapping: Built scalable templates for unique asset types
  3. Custom “Hybrid Checkout” Flow: Allowed users to fund large transactions using both in-app balances and external methods—encouraging deposits without introducing friction
  4. Investment Comparison Framework: Designed side-by-side views to let users compare opportunities like fractional real estate or closed-end funds
  5. Design System Development: Delivered a fully documented UI library to enable phased rollout and cross-team developer collaboration

Results & Impact

  1. Simplified interface enabled both novice and experienced investors to explore alternatives with confidence
  2. Created a scalable infrastructure for future investment types (crypto, funds, real assets)
  3. Unique purchase logic directly aligned with behavioral finance principles—encouraging deposits and conversions
  4. Secured multiple strategic partnerships ahead of launch (including crypto brokerages)
  5. Positioned GBix to go to market with a strong, differentiated product in Q1 2024
